Time the record covers
At most 8.2 million years on record.
Every occurrence read is dated to somewhere between 121.4 Mya and 113.2 Mya, and nothing in the dating separates them, so that window is what the record shows rather than a span.
2 occurrences of Hypacanthoplites sigmoidalis on record, most of them in the Early Cretaceous.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.
